"The Forest Exiles: The Perils of a Peruvian Family in the Wilds of the Amazon" by Mayne Reid plunges readers into a thrilling adventure set against the backdrop of the mighty Amazon River. This classic tale of survival unfolds within the heart of the Peruvian forest, as a family confronts the untamed wilderness. Reid, a master of action and adventure, crafts a gripping narrative that explores the challenges and dangers faced by those who dare to make their home in the remote corners of the world. Experience the thrill of exploration and the resilience of the human spirit as this historical fiction transports you to a bygone era. Journey along the Amazon and discover the perils and wonders that await in "The Forest Exiles," a testament to the enduring power of family and the lure of the unknown.
